Discover Abuelita's Restaurant

Walking into Abuelita's Restaurant on Saticoy Street feels a lot like stepping into a family kitchen where everyone is welcome and nobody leaves hungry. The first time I ate here, I came in after a long workday expecting a quick bite, and I ended up staying far longer than planned because the food and atmosphere pulled me in. Located at 16060 Saticoy St, Van Nuys, CA 91406, United States, this neighborhood diner has quietly built a loyal following among locals who care about flavor, consistency, and real comfort food.

The menu reads like a love letter to traditional Mexican home cooking. You’ll find classics such as enchiladas, tamales, pozole, and carne asada, all prepared with the kind of care that usually comes from generations of practice. According to culinary research from the National Restaurant Association, diners are increasingly drawn to restaurants that offer authentic regional flavors, and this place clearly fits that trend. What stands out is how the recipes stay simple without feeling basic. The beans taste slow-cooked, the rice is fluffy and seasoned just right, and the tortillas have that soft, fresh texture that’s hard to fake.

One dish I always recommend is the menudo, especially on weekends. I once spoke with a regular who drives over 20 minutes just for it, and after trying it myself, I understood why. The broth is rich but not heavy, and the balance of spices feels intentional rather than overpowering. Another customer at the next table called it the real deal, and that reaction felt completely earned. These small, unscripted moments say more than any advertisement ever could.

Service here leans friendly and familiar. On my third visit, one of the servers remembered my usual order, which lines up with hospitality studies from Cornell University showing that personalized service significantly increases customer satisfaction and repeat visits. You’re not rushed, and questions about the menu are answered patiently. That sense of trust builds quickly, especially for first-time visitors who might feel overwhelmed by a long list of options.

The location in Van Nuys makes it accessible whether you’re stopping by for breakfast, lunch, or an early dinner. Parking is straightforward, and the dining room stays clean and well-organized, even during busy hours. Reviews online consistently mention the welcoming vibe and generous portions, and while no restaurant is perfect, most criticisms are minor, such as wait times during peak hours. From my experience, the wait is usually worth it, especially when the food arrives hot and clearly made to order.

From an industry perspective, restaurants that focus on consistency tend to outlast trend-driven spots. Food analysts from Eater often point out that diners return to places where they know exactly what they’re getting, and that reliability is a major strength here. The flavors don’t change randomly, and the portions stay satisfying. That kind of dependability builds credibility over time.

Another detail worth mentioning is how family-oriented the space feels. I’ve seen birthday breakfasts, casual business lunches, and multi-generational dinners all happening at once. One mother at a nearby table smiled and said the restaurant felt just like home, and that sentiment captures the overall experience better than any formal description.

There are limitations, of course. If you’re looking for modern fusion dishes or a trendy cocktail list, this may not be your spot. The focus stays firmly on traditional food and straightforward drinks. Still, that clarity of purpose is part of why the restaurant works so well. It knows what it is and doesn’t pretend to be anything else.

Between the well-loved menu, the convenient Van Nuys location, and the steady stream of positive reviews, this restaurant has earned its reputation through everyday consistency rather than hype. Each visit reinforces the feeling that the people behind the counter genuinely care about the food they serve and the community they feed.
